Primary Purpose:

Provides career advisement to graduate students and alumni about choosing or changing a career direction, identifying career goals, establishing a plan of action, writing a resume or cover letter, preparing for an interview, conducting a job or internship search, and
other issues related to career planning process.

Essential Job Functions: 

1. Establishes a plan of action with the student/alumni working towards preparing for a successful career.

2. Provides career advising to individual students through career goal setting, formal and informal career exploration, and offers appropriate career-related resources both on and off campus. Delivers on-going support through the decision-making process.

3. Supports students in creating and developing their personal portfolio, cover letters, interviewing skills and other professional tools required to ultimately conduct a successful internship or job search.

4. Provides, administers, and evaluates various assessment tools to students/alumni to identify their career interests, preferred work environments, and how to make decisions about career choices.

5. Assists graduate and professional schools in generating a reputation of excellence within the university.

6. Assists with planning, promoting, and delivering workshops and seminars, and classroom outreach, on resume writing, interviewing techniques, job search strategies, business communication, employer expectations, networking and social media, and other career-related topics.

7. Contributes to the research of current trends and employers in all industries as it pertains to employment outlook and other areas that affect career decisions.

8. Assists in the organization, implementation, and coordination of department special events and programming.

9. Assists with the compiling and maintaining of data and assessment for surveys and reports.

10. Completes other projects as assigned.

11. Performs other duties as assigned or required.
